What Is a Settlement Statement?
According to Sonic Title experts who serve Chelsea and Metro Detroit, a settlement statement is a comprehensive document detailing all the financial aspects of a real estate transaction. This document, often referred to as the ALTA statement, includes the purchase price, loan amounts, prorations, fees, and the cash needed to close. For Chelsea residents, understanding this document is crucial to ensure a smooth closing process. The settlement statement acts as a final checklist, ensuring that every financial detail is accounted for before the keys are handed over. It is essential for buyers to review this document closely to avoid any discrepancies that could delay the closing process.

Key Components of a Settlement Statement
Line-by-Line Breakdown
A common question we hear at Sonic Title is: "What exactly does each line of the settlement statement mean?" Each line of your settlement statement covers specific transaction details. For instance, you'll see the purchase price, loan charges, and prorations for taxes. Understanding these lines helps you verify that all financial obligations are accurately recorded. Additionally, the statement includes sections for title insurance, recording fees, and any applicable credits or debits. By carefully reviewing each line, buyers can ensure that there are no hidden costs and that all agreed-upon terms are reflected in the final document.
Common Fees and Charges
Another frequent inquiry is about the fees listed in the statement. These can include loan origination fees, title insurance, and escrow charges. In addition to these standard fees, buyers should also be aware of potential costs such as homeowners association dues or special assessments, which can impact the overall budget. Common Mistakes to Avoid
Overlooking Small Details
One of the most common challenges we help Chelsea families overcome is overlooking small details in the settlement statement. Even minor errors can lead to significant issues. Always double-check figures and ensure all terms match your expectations. It's important to verify that all personal information is correct and that any negotiated terms, such as seller concessions or repair credits, are accurately reflected. By paying attention to these details, buyers can avoid potential disputes or delays at closing.
